Hyundai Ioniq: Rear View Monitor (RVM) / Repair procedures
1. | Disconnect the negative (-) battery terminal. |
2. | Remove the tailgate lid trim. (Refer to Body - "TailGate Lid Trim") |
3. | Disconnect the Rear view camera connector (A). |
4. | Remove the Rear view camera assembly after loosening the mounting screws. |
1. | Install the back view camera. |
2. | Install the tailgate lid trim. |
3. | Connect the negative (-) battery terminal. |
